Growth, biomass and lipid productivity of a newly isolated tropical marine diatom, Skeletonema sp. UHO29, under different light intensities

Abstract: Abstract. Indrayani I, Haslianti H, Asmariani A, Muskita WH, Balubi M. 2020. Growth, biomass and lipid productivity of a newly isolated tropical marine diatom, Skeletonema sp. UHO29, under different light intensities. Biodiversitas 21: 1498-1503. Light is one of the important factors affecting growth and biochemical composition of microalgae. The aim of this study was to determine growth, biomass and lipid productivity of a newly isolated marine diatom, Skeletonema sp.UHO29 under different light intensities. T… Show more

“…The filtered seawater is then kept in a 1000 mL Erlenmeyer and wrapped in aluminum foil for the following sterilization process using an autoclave (Wiseclave WACS-1045). The seawater sterilization was done at 121°C for 15 minutes to ensure the absence of contamination by biotic pathogens (Indrayani et al 2018(Indrayani et al , 2019(Indrayani et al , 2021. The seawater filtering and preparation were carried out at the Productivity and Aquatic Environment Laboratory, Faculty of Fisheries and Marine Sciences, Halu Oleo University, Kendari, Indonesia.…”
